Coimbatore: Police arrested Palaninathan, an ex-serviceman for snatching an eight sovereign gold chain from a woman Radhamani near Veerapandi pirivu.

According to police, the woman was travelling on the pillion of a two-wheeler with her son in Veerapandi pirivu area when bike- borne miscreants snatched her chain.

Radhamani, a resident of Jyothipuram in Veerapandi pirivu, was on her way to a private hospital with her son in a two-wheeler on Mettupalayam road, when the duo riding a two-wheeler snatched the 8-sovereign Thali chain from Radhamani.

Radhamani's son, however, gave chase to the duo and caught them with the help of the members of the public. However, one of them escaped with the snatched “Thali” chain.

During Police interrogation, the police found that the arrested person is Palaninathan (43), a native of Ramanathapuram district and an ex-serviceman. It was also revealed that he was suspended seven years ago from the armed forces.

They are also on the lookout for the second person, Murugananthan, who escaped with the chain.

The police have registered a case against him and are investigating.

The arrested man was remanded in custody.
